How to Succeed at Offshore Banking

By: Peter Waterhaze

The process of offshore banking is something that not many people know about when it comes to taking care of their finances. However, conducting some of your financial business outside the borders of your own country is something that is fairly easy to set up and manage.

The most common question is: is offshore banking legal? The answer is that offshore banking is very legal. There are many large American corporations that use offshore banks (those outside of the United States) for the majority of their banking. These corporations include Boeing and Exxon, among other large and well known companies. But you don't need to be a large corporation to use offshore banking.

Many corporation and individuals use offshore banking for some of their investments because the want to protect their interests. Offshore banking offers opportunity to help you increase your wealth. There are at times many tax benefits available with foreign banks. You can perhaps deposit your money into accounts in the countries that do not levy taxes on the interest that you earn while depositing money with them. So it would be to your advantage to take time to research the options of offshore banking that you can avail. You can then put your savings and other money into these types of tax protected accounts.

One other advantage of offshore banking is that you may conduct your banking business in other currencies, such as the currency of the bank. This means that you can use the differences in currency rates to increase your profits if you invest and deposit your money carefully.
